The MAX6800/MAX6801/MAX6802 microprocessor (µP)
supervisory circuits monitor the power supplies in 2.85V
to 5.0V µP and digital systems. They increase circuit
reliability and reduce cost by eliminating external com-
ponents and adjustments.
These devices perform a single function—they assert a
reset signal whenever the V
below a preset threshold, keeping it asserted for a preset
timeout period after V
threshold. The only difference among the three devices
is their output. The MAX6801 (push/pull) and MAX6802
(open-drain) have an active-low RESET output, while the
MAX6800 (push/pull) has an active-high RESET output.
The MAX6800/MAX6801 are guaranteed to be in the cor-
rect state for V
teed to be in the correct state for V
The reset comparator in these ICs is designed to ignore
fast transients on V
trimmable between 2.63V and 4.80V, in approximately
100mV increments. These devices are available with a
1ms (min), 20ms (min), or 100ms (min) reset pulse
width. Ideal for space-critical applications, the
MAX6800/MAX6801/MAX6802 come packaged in a 3-
pin SOT23. For a lower threshold voltage version, see
the MAX6332/MAX6333/MAX6334.

* These devices are available in factory-set V
olds from 2.63V to 4.80V, in approximately 0.1V increments.
Choose the desired reset threshold suffix from Table 1 and
insert it in the blanks following “UR” in the part number.
Factory-programmed reset timeout periods are also available.
Insert the number corresponding to the desired nominal reset
timeout period (1 = 1ms min, 2 = 20ms min, 3 = 100ms min) in
the blank following “D” in the part number. There are 15 stan-
dard versions with a required order increment of 2500 pieces.
Sample stock is generally held on the standard versions only
(see Selector Guide). Contact the factory for availability of non-
standard versions (required order increment is 10,000 pieces).
All devices available in tape-and-reel only.
Devices are available in both leaded and lead-free packaging.
Specify lead-free by replacing “-T” with “+T” when ordering.
